#916e16 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#916e16 is composed of 56.9% red, 43.1% green and 8.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 24.1% magenta, 84.8% yellow and 43.1% black. It has a hue angle of 42.9 degrees, a saturation of 73.7% and a lightness of 32.7%. #916e16 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ffdc2c with #230000. Closest websafe color is: #996600.

#916e16 color description : Dark orange [Brown tone].

#916e16 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#916e16 has RGB values of R:145, G:110, B:22 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.24, Y:0.85, K:0.43. Its decimal value is 9530902.

Shades and Tints of #916e16

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090701 is the darkest color, while #fefcf7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#916e16

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#575550 is the less saturated color, while #a47603 is the most saturated one.
